High school students receive scholarships at luncheon

MILWAUKEE (WITI) -- Thirty high school students received scholarships at a luncheon at Milwaukee's City Hall on Wednesday, May 1st.

McDonald's supports the Ronald McDonald House Charities (RMHC) scholarship program, which distributed a total of $60,000 in 2013.

The program assists students of all backgrounds with several scholarships including: Asian-Pacific Students Increasing Achievement (RMHC/ASIA), African American Future Achievers (RMHC/Future Achievers), Hispanic American Commitment to Education Resources (RMHC/HACER) and general academic scholarships (RMHC/Scholars).

In honor of the recipients, McDonald’s arranged Wednesday's luncheon which included special transportation to-and-from school via limousine.  They also had a special opportunity to meet at Milwaukee’s City Hall with community leaders, area dignitaries and have lunch at the InterContinental Milwaukee Hotel.
